3. What data reports does the system deliver?

Drinks poured versus drinks billed, low inventory, iregularity reports (under & overpouring, missing, and unauthorized inventory), consumption analysis, and shift comparision. If you require additional reports, we can make it available.

5. Can anyone cheat the system?

We’re tempted to say NO, but being an experienced former F&B Managers we know not to uder estimate the creativity of your staff. To not quite sem too self-confident we will safelt say that we can easily detect 90% of all liquor inventory manipulation.

For Example:

  • Backpour: Our system will detect any irregular influx of liquor
  • Non-registered bottles: The system flags all unregistered bottles
  • Missing Bottles: Registered bottles can be given a designated time by which they have to be placed back on scale after being removed. If they are not, they are flagged as missing until replaced.

15. How does the system recognize alcohol poured straight or in a cocktail?

Our system can recognize a straight poured alcohol, and alcohol poured in a mixed cocktail form. Further, it allows you to enter ingredients of all cocktails into our recipe mix, which then aligns alcohol poured to the most likely drink/cocktail posted to your POS-System.

21. Is your system susceptible to wetness, sugar or alcohol?

Our system works with electronic elements and circuits. All of these are sealed and water proofed. Our speed rails have a clever run-off system for liquids, so that liquids do not even get close to the electronic elements.
